  • Abstract
    E-learning has become one of most important means for the future education, especially for universities. This paper is based on our e-learning teaching experience which comes from one of the leading e-learning university, the University of Southern Queensland. We use the workflow mechanism to analyse the e-learning system. The whole e-learning system is divided into four sub-workflow systems, teaching sub-workflow, learning sub-workflow, admin sub-workflow and infrastructure sub-workflow. Through a coherent analyse of co-relationship of main activities in four sub-workflow systems, some activities are identified as the key elements for the e-learning system. By enhancing these key elements, the performance of all the e-learning workflow gets a significant improvement and e-learning students get better grades than on-campus and traditional distance students. The workflow-based e-learning system can effectively reach the expected achievement of e-learning.
